The structural rating also includes Kansas's licensing baseline — what every licensed daycare in the state must meet. Kansas caps infant ratios at 1:3, toddler ratios at 1:6, and preschool ratios at 1:12. Lead teachers must hold a High School Diploma. Teachers must complete 16 hours of annual training. Inspection History

2 Inspection Visits Since 2024 · 14 Findings · 0% Corrected at Visit
Most recent: Jun 25, 2025Download Latest Report (PDF)
1 Critical8 Important5 Administrative

Across 2 inspections since 2024, the issues cited most often were Staff Qualifications & Background Checks (7), Building & Premises Safety (4), and Infectious Disease Prevention & Control (2). Of 14 total findings, 1 was critical.

See All 2 Inspection Visits
  1. Jun 25, 20259 Findings1 Critical5 Important3 Administrative
    • Background ChecksK.A.R. 28-4-125

      Facility did not submit identifying information for two individuals as required to complete background checks.

    • Health of Persons 16 Years or Older in Child Care FacilitiesK.A.R. 28-4-126

      Negative TB test results are not on file for two people living in the home.

    • Health of Persons 16 Years or Older in Child Care FacilitiesK.A.R. 28-4-126

      Health status form is not on file for provider.

    • Safety and Emergency ProceduresK.A.R. 28-4-128

      Emergency plans are not developed.

    • AnimalsK.A.R. 28-4-131

      Rabies certificate was not on file for one dog.

    • Child Care PracticesK.A.R. 28-4-132

      Discipline policy was not available.

    • Applicant; LicenseeK.A.R. 28-4-114

      License was not posted.

    • SupervisionK.A.R. 28-4-115

      2A 10B:C fire extinguisher is not available.

    • SupervisionK.A.R. 28-4-115a

      Written supervision plan was not available.

  2. Jun 6, 20245 Findings3 Important2 Administrative
    • Health of Persons 16 Years or Older in Child Care FacilitiesK.A.R. 28-4-126

      Health assessment not on file for provider.

    • Health of Persons 16 Years or Older in Child Care FacilitiesK.A.R. 28-4-126

      Negative TB test not on file for one adult.

    • Child Care PracticesK.A.R. 28-4-132

      Written discipline policy not developed.

    • Applicant; LicenseeK.A.R. 28-4-114

      Temporary license not posted.

    • SupervisionK.A.R. 28-4-115

      Stairs to basement accessible by unsecured door. Gate needed in outdoor play area at stairs going up to deck.
